Where
Where

Jobs and careers for service desk support in Stafford (1 jobs)

Company
Schedule
Employment
Source
Location
Sort by:
  • Ariel Partners
  • Stafford
... Help Desk Manager to lead and oversee Tier 1 and Tier 2 support operations ... have extensive experience managing help desk teams, resolving technical issues, and ...
21 hours ago